So, not sure if you mean how many songs it can read per file? If that's what you meant, 1000. I thought I'd messed something up when transferring them so did it again, still 1000. If you back up your i-phone / i-pods to your computer (PC) you can just drag the complete i-tunes folder onto an SD card; all the artwork etc appears on the PCM screen too.
